Preliminary Investigation Shows Rising Sun Woman Died from Natural Causes

Shutterstock photo.

(Ohio County, Ind.) – An investigation is underway following the death of a Rising Sun woman. 

On Friday, February 28, the Ohio County Sheriff’s Office responded to a 911 call from the resident where Brandy Hendricks was found unresponsive.

Life-saving efforts were performed, but unsuccessful.

An autopsy was conducted on Saturday and the preliminary cause of death has been determined to be of natural causes due to medical complications.
